Title: | Issues on the integration of renewable energy with existing power distribution networks | Authors: | Cheang, Poi Yee | Keywords: | DRNTU::Engineering::Electrical and electronic engineering::Electric power | Issue Date: | 2010 | Abstract: | Photovoltaic systems comprises of photovoltaic cells that converts sunlight into electrical power, producing current which is useful for daily applications especially producing clean for the benefit of the environment. The photovoltaic system output mainly depends on the insolation, temperature and changing atmospheric conditions and in this dissertation, varying insolation is simulated to study the characteristic of the photovoltaic system. | Description: | 95 p. | URI: | http://hdl.handle.net/10356/46971 | Schools: | School of Electrical and Electronic Engineering | Rights: | Nanyang Technological University | Fulltext Permission: | restricted | Fulltext Availability: | With Fulltext |
